Freedoms Journal Institute for the Study Policy (EIN: 27-4681473) has filed an IRS Form 990 since fiscal year 2018. In its fiscal year 2024 IRS Form 990 filing, Freedoms Journal Institute for the Study Policy, a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 7 employ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$23,660. The highest compensated employee at Freedoms Journal Institute for the Study Policy is Dr Eric M Wallace with fiscal year 2024 compensation of $28,583.

FREEDOM'S JOURNAL INSTITUTE EXISTS TO EDUCATE, ENGAGE, AND EMPOWER INDIVIDUALS ON ISSUES OF FAITH, RACE, AND PUBLIC POLICY. OUR WORK IS ROOTED IN THE CONVICTION THAT BIBLICAL VALUES SHOULD SHAPE CULTURE, GUIDE POLICY, EMPOWER COMMUNITIES, AND DEFEND FAITH, FAMILY, AND FREEDOM. EVERYTHING WE DO FLOWS FROM THIS VISION. WE CHAMPION A BIBLICAL WORLDVIEW BY EQUIPPING LEADERS, FOSTERING DIALOGUE, AND PROVIDING RESOURCES THAT ADDRESS THE CULTURAL CHALLENGES OF OUR DAY. THROUGH EVENTS SUCH AS THE BLACK CONSERVATIVE SUMMIT, NEW PUBLICATIONS, AND UPCOMING MEDIA PROJECTS, WE SEEK TO STRENGTHEN FAMILIES, INSPIRE CIVIC ENGAGEMENT, AND INFLUENCE THE PUBLIC SQUARE WITH TRUTH AND INTEGRITY.
